Your carpet can look completely fine and still be the wrong thing to trust.

The carpet face: dries fast, vacuums clean, looks normal within a day or two of a spill.

The pad underneath: holds many times its own weight in water, sits flat against the subfloor, and dries slowly or not at all.

That is why a spot that looked handled in July can smell sour by August. The face dried. The pad did not.

When we pull carpet back, the pad tells the real story. Sometimes it can be dried in place. Sometimes it has to go.

Most people never look under the bathroom sink unless something is already wrong.

Take a look this week anyway. Those flexible supply lines feeding your faucet have a shelf life. If they are original to the house, they are past due. They rarely drip when they fail. They let go all at once.

Braided stainless replacements are cheap and take ten minutes.

When a toilet, tub, or washing machine overflows, the type of water matters more than people realize.

➡️ A clean supply line leak is sanitary, so the focus is fast drying
➡️ A washing machine or dishwasher overflow carries soaps and grime, so it gets disinfected, not just dried
➡️ A toilet or sewage backup is its own category, carrying bacteria, and porous materials it touched usually have to be removed

We sort out which category you are dealing with before anything else, because that decision drives the whole job. Treating dirty water like clean water is how people end up sick or living over mold.

If you have pets, you already know surface cleaning does not solve a pet accident. Here is why.

Urine soaks straight through the carpet into the pad and sometimes the subfloor underneath. Scrubbing the top does nothing for what soaked below, which is why the smell keeps coming back on humid days.

A proper enzyme treatment breaks down the source down in the pad, not just the stain you can see. That is the difference between covering a smell and actually removing it.

Wind-driven rain finds gaps in your home that a normal rainstorm never touches.

In a regular shower, rain falls straight down, and your roof and walls shed it the way they are built to. In a tropical system, the wind drives that rain sideways and even upward, forcing it into seams around windows, under door thresholds, and through roof vents.

That is why a house that has stayed bone dry for years can suddenly leak in a hurricane. Nothing broke. The water just got pushed somewhere it normally cannot reach.

After any big blow, check the inside corners of exterior walls and the ceilings near the roof. Catching it early keeps it from turning into mold behind the wall.

After a storm, the damage you can see from the ground is rarely the whole story.

Three things worth a closer look this hurricane season:
1️⃣ Missing shingles are obvious, but cracked flashing and lifted edges are not. Those small gaps let wind-driven rain straight in.
2️⃣ Soft spots or dark streaks on the underside of eaves often mean water already got past the roofline and is sitting somewhere.
3️⃣ Inside, check the top corners of exterior walls and ceilings near the roof. That is where hidden roof leaks tend to surface first.

A roof can look fine from the driveway and still be letting water in. When in doubt, get a real look before the next system rolls through.
